My favorite thing though is online jigsaw puzzles. I use jigzone.com- it's free and they have a new one every day plus tons and tons of old ones. You can even upload your own photos to have them made into puzzles, plus tons of different cuts (not just your traditional pieces) to choose from. It times you to, so I have fun racing against the average time to see if I can beat it. That keeps me busy for hours.
